Your department:

Our modern Finance function is at the core of our business, helping to inform the major decisions that impact our projects and activities, and funding the world’s transition to a greener energy future. Our Finance employees are highly valued business partners with strategic and operational focus and are the catalyst for driving our business transformation.

Within that framework the department Financial Reporting Global Market Operations is responsible for the Financial Reporting for the segment Market Operations. The department ensures timely and correct reporting to the group finance department under IFRS as well as compliance with the Internal Controls. The team is located both in Oslo and Dusseldorf.
